Output 802a2973f6c609abbf7e73901ed9d174fb634c5d82b5c0c125c64d9d45b90f20:1

value
4256565374
script pubkey
OP_0 OP_PUSHBYTES_20 58bcee030a56124ad8ef49dc0981c147582f590c
address
tb1qtz7wuqc22cfy4k80f8wqnqwpgavz7kgvupghvu
transaction
802a2973f6c609abbf7e73901ed9d174fb634c5d82b5c0c125c64d9d45b90f20
confirmations
111886
spent
true